Mutation Underlies Fatal Heart Condition

A 15-year-long project finally bore fruit after researchers painstakingly identified a specific gene mutation that can lead to sudden heart failure in otherwise healthy-looking young people. The gene in question, named CDH2, carries the instructions for cells to build N-cadherin. This protein binds adjacent heart muscle cells together like mortar between bricks. With faulty mortar, bricks may stack up just fine, but they can suddenly collapse in a strong wind. A similar tragedy occurs with a CDH2 mutation. This error in the instructional code produces warped N-cadherin that leaves vital heart cells with a weak attachment to one another.

Dr. Guillaume Paré from McMaster University led the genetic sequencing aspect of the project. A McMaster University news report stated that, in the absence of immediate medical aid, the mutation can sometimes "causes sudden death in a few minutes."1

Other members of the team worked with a South African family who had lost several loved ones to this mutation-caused disease. The researchers found coding errors in the same CDH2 gene from multiple families, ruling out DNA differences in other genes. With this discovery, affected but informed families can take steps toward interventions.
